About the Role
As a Specialist Obesity Dietitian, you will support patients with weight management by assessing their nutritional intake, micronutrient status, and psychological wellbeing. Your role will involve a mixture of face-to-face, video, and telephone clinics. You will utilize strong behaviour change skills to facilitate positive changes in patients' lifestyles. Additionally, you will facilitate group education sessions for patients and play a key role in multidisciplinary team (MDT) meetings, supporting best interest decisions.
